Treet Corporation Limited has announced a significant expansion in its Hygiene Razor segment following exceptionally high sales and strong market demand that have exceeded the company’s current production capacity.
In a statement shared with the Pakistan Stock Exchange (PSX), the company said that its Board of Directors has approved a capital expenditure of PKR 430 million to enhance production capabilities in the Hygiene Razor segment.
According to the statement, this strategic investment aims to enable Treet Corporation to meet increasing demand in both local and export markets, improve operational efficiency, and further enhance shareholder value.
The company expressed confidence that the expansion will strengthen its market position and support sustainable growth in the personal care sector. – ER News Desk
